Output 4cb32384a15331c34f90f29bff0f1b9fd22492237d6e88874b2e18d902b14876:1

value
1290537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fa094a20f7b8c57c712937f9efdb6c928dcfac OP_EQUAL
address
3EzsSBgWsTLgjsbzhGRHmq7cqB79ZSaQfC
transaction
4cb32384a15331c34f90f29bff0f1b9fd22492237d6e88874b2e18d902b14876
spent
true